359 Pitt St, Sydney 2000 is a 55-lot building with 8 recorded sales since 2021, including 6 in the last 3 years. Studio rents have a median of $700/wk, with the middle half of rents at $670–$775/wk. 1-bedroom rents have a median of $900/wk ($800–$1100/wk for the middle half), 2-bedroom rents a median of $1400/wk ($1200–$1650/wk), and 3-bedroom rents a median of $2300/wk ($1825–$2775/wk).
